Subject: Kiosk watchdog cut-over — done

Team — WardenLoop watchdog cut-over for the Brinmore kiosks completed at 03:10 local. Old poller decommissioned, new heartbeat checks live on all 42 units. One kiosk needed a manual reboot; otherwise clean. No rollback expected. The active configuration after cut-over is as follows.

deployment values, bafop-fadup:
[belath]
team = oliius
access_code = ac_015d0e
host = belath.orvexcloud.example
port = 11211
owner = ulaael.ralael
peer = gorir.qirvanforge.corp

Heads up, plugin folks: if your Glimmerboard admin theme extension locks you out after the dark-mode toggle migration, don't panic. Reset your sandbox account from the Glimmerboard dev portal and re-link your theme manifest. If the portal itself rejects you, use the recovery flow with the passphrase shown on the next line.

strongbox words: wenix-ulador

## Incremental Rebuilds (Glimmerpress)

Glimmerpress rebuilds only pages whose content hash changed. Release cuts trigger a full rebuild; do not cancel it mid-run or the manifest desyncs. Check the rebuild dashboard before tagging. If the diff count looks wrong (over ~500 pages for a routine release), stop and escalate. Rebuild anomalies and manifest resets go to the static pipeline crew.

escalation mailbox, fafof-bahip: tamael@ordincorp.test